New Triple plate Tilton Button clutch fitted, new 6 wheel Brian James Trailer to save having to get underneath to strap it down where people can drop winch hooks on me head, same old head!

Actually John if you are interested I found the problem with the organic clutch that was fitted and the Tilton is really overkill for the power of the engine but I had it anyhow, what had happened was it was a faulty release bearing which managed to snag itself on to the spigot shaft housing and jam the clutch open which rapidly burnt out, most unusual.

Well Al, don't forget that a lot of the old specialist car makers, certainly in the UK, built in small numbers and lived a hand to mouth existence; they rarely saw profit, so cost saving by buying in parts from larger more established manufacturers was a well worn practice back in the 60s and 70s. TVR were one of those to do that and one of the very few to survive. Less excuse for products like the Range Rover, I agree.
